MS Dhoni, at 43 years old, continues to play competitive cricket in the IPL 2025 season, captivating fans with his skill and leadership as the former CSK skipper. In a recent interview with Raj Shamani, Dhoni opened up about his childhood in Ranchi, admitting to feeling fear towards his father due to his strict and regimented nature. Despite this fear, Dhoni emphasized that there was no insecurity in his childhood, with a routine life and no room for showmanship or distractions like mobile phones. He recalled the disciplined upbringing he and his brother received, with teachers who knew their family well and a competitive spirit fostered through games in their colony.

Dhoni confessed, “Papa se darr bohot lagta tha (I used to be really scared of my father),” attributing his own regimented nature to his father’s influence.
